On 28/02/2008, Roger Bivand <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> wrote: > > On Thu, 28 Feb 2008, Hamish wrote: > > > Roger: > >> Some grass modules don't support --interface-description, but I think > >> not many. > > > > r.mapcalc being the primary concern. Most of the remaining rest are > > interactive things which wouldn't be useful from R. I don't think it's > > a huge effort to do something special for r.mapcalc, chances are you > > might want to do something special with it anyway. > > > > You can use the r.mapcalculator script as a frontend if you need one > > with a working --interface-description. > > > Right, had found that, thanks! > > I'd argue that r.mapcalculator will be good enough. If users need all the > strength of r.mapcalc, they can say system("bash") and do it from the > shell, returning to R by closing the shell. The history file for the > under-shell will not, however, be recorded (at least not in the same > place).
I actually managed to get r.mapcalc working quite nicely without any hassles so far. I agree that this could be excluded from the do_GRASS() or at least get internally a special treatment (r.mapcalc was actually one reason why I used GRASS from R as it was much easier then using internal R mechanisms for that.)
